101 W Main St Ste 101
Delphi, IN 46923 - Carroll County
(765) 564-3420
About County of Carroll:
County of Carroll - Health Department is located at 101 W Main St Ste 101 in Delphi, IN - Carroll County and is a county government agency specialized in Government. County of Carroll is listed in the categories City & County Administrative Agencies and Government Offices County. After you do business with County of Carroll,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to County of Carroll.
Categories: City & County Administrative Agencies and Government Offices County
Specialties: Government
- Health Department
